Kakharupanha - Sukruli, Mayurbhanj

Kakharupanha is a village situated in the Sukruli tehsil of Mayurbhanj district, Odisha. It is located approximately 1 km from Raruan and around 131 km from Baripada. Sukruli ser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kakharupanha village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kakharupanha is 388698. The village covers a total geographical area of 31 hectares and falls under the 757035 pincode. Karanjia is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.

Kakharupanha village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Jashipur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mayurbhanj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kakharupanha

According to the 2011 Census, Kakharupanha village had a total population of 825 people, including 353 males and 472 females, living in 154 households. The sex ratio was 1,337 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 81.19%, with male literacy at 86.29% and female literacy at 77.42%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 128,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 337.

Transport and Connectivity of Kakharupanha

Kakharupanha is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Karanjia to Kakharupanha is about 22 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Baripada to Kakharupanha is about 131 km, with the usual travel time around ~3.7 hours.
